    General Chapter 2021 - Preparation


     CSJ - Zoom  training for General Chapter 2021

     

    We are in a time that obliges us to social distance due to the pandemic. As we are caged in our own homes, Pope Francis has come up with an apt message for the 55th World Communications Day – “Come and see: Communicating, encountering people as and where they are.”

     

    The ICC (International Commission for Communication) paved way towards this message by communicating and encountering people as and where they are through video conference via zoom platform.

     

    As our 30th General Chapter with its vibrant and richest theme – “Community immersed in the spirit connected with the world” is all set, the pandemic has taught us to go online for some of its sessions. For the smooth running of these sessions, it was must that our delegates acquaint with the modern technology.

     

    This training took place in two phases. The first one was on May 21 for the Asian delegates (China, India and Pakistan) and the second one was on May 29 for the Brazil and Bolivian delegates. The Provincials, Chapter Delegates, Alternates, ICC members, the interpreters Sr. Joana Mendes (Sister of St. Joseph of Lyon, Rochester), Sr. Preeti and Sr. Ieda, the liaison between ICC and General Team were present.

    CSJ BRAZIL & BOLIVIA

     

    After the training session with the English speaking Sisters from Asia, it was the turn of the Brazilians. On May 29, the delegates to the General Chapter and alternates who speak and understand Portuguese, gathered for a videoconference via Zoom platform to receive some practical guidance. Sisters Eliana and Laveena, members of the CIC, were responsible for organizing and conducting this test session. Sr. Joana Mendes of the Sisters of St. Joseph of Rochester contributed at this time with the translation from English into Portuguese.

     

     

    The objective was to train the delegates the use of the “interpretation” options which helps the particpants to listen to the speakers in their own language. Furthermore the sisters were guided on the issues such as renaming, using breakrooms and other different icons which will help them to participate well during the sessions.
